Renoir is a painter who most people admire.,
what is the antecedent

Respuesta :

metchelle
metchelle metchelle
  • 30-06-2016
An antecedent is the word or noun that is being referred by the pronoun used in the sentence. The word antecedent is a Latin word that means "to go before". In the given sentence above, the antecedent is the word "Renoir" which is referred by the relative pronoun "who".
